Always gives the same output for a given set of inputs. Even though cad tools are used to create combinational logic circuits in practice, it is important that a digital designer should learn how to generate a logic circuit from a specification. Circuitverse contains most primary circuit elements from both combinational and sequential circuit design. In this type of logic circuits outputs depend only on the current inputs. Circuitverse online digital logic circuit simulator. Analyzing and synthesizing combinational logic circuits. Latches and flipflops, synchronous sequential circuit design and analysis. Given the timing information for the registers and the combination logic, some sys. Combinational logic circuits that were described earlier have the property that the output. Sequential circuits basics electronics hub latest free. To synthesize the text coverage of combinational and sequential design methods, the author uses a detailed case study of a simple processor design in the.
Designing asynchronous sequential circuits for random pattern testability article pdf available in iee proceedings computers and digital techniques 1424. Pdf designing asynchronous sequential circuits for random. Avoid to use latches as possible in synchronous sequential circuits to avoid design problems 58 sr latch. Digital logic circuits by bakshi pdf free download download. Ppt sequential circuits powerpoint presentation free to. The book provides comprehensive coverage of programmable logic, including roms, pals, and plas. Digital electronics part i combinational and sequential logic. Yet virtually all useful systems require storage of. Current state and next state outputs are 3 bits each. A practical matters section concludes most chapters, which ties theory to practice and explains design technologies in detail. Digital systems, number systems and codes, boolean algebra and switching functions, representations of logic functions, combinational logic design, combinational logic minimization, timing issues, common combinational logic circuits, latches and flipflops, synchronous sequential circuit analysis, synchronous. Digital logic design engineering and computer science program. Binary counters simple design b bits can count from 0 to 2b. Specifically, the input must be stable at least t setup before the clock edge at least until t hold after the clock edge.
Pdf design and implementation of reversible sequential circuits. Since there is no clock, they dont require triggering. Later, we will study circuits having a stored internal state, i. A circuit with two crosscoupled nor gates or two crosscoupled nand gates.
The input to a synchronous sequential circuit must be stable during the aperture setup and hold time around the clock edge. Modeling combinational logic as a processall signals referenced in process must be in the sensitivity list. If you continue browsing the site, you agree to the use of cookies on this website. Asynchronous sequential circuits analysis procedure circuits with latches design procedure reduction of state and flow tables racefree state assignment hazards design example 918 latches in asynchronous circuits the traditional configuration of asynchronous circuits is using one or more feedback loops no real delay elements. Number systemand codes, boolean algebra and logic gates, boolean algebra and logic gates, combinational logic, synchronous sequential logic, memory and programmable logic, register transfer levels, digital integrated logic circuits. Universal length 4 sequence detector this one detects 1011 or 0101 or 0001 or 0111 sequence transformation serial binary adder arbitrary length operands 0 1 000 011 101 010 100 111 110 001 elec 326 8 sequential circuit design 2. Combinational logic a combinational system device is a digital system in which the value of the output at any instant depends only on the value of the input at that same instant and not on previous values. A free powerpoint ppt presentation displayed as a flash slide show on id. The jk flipflop is the most widely used of all the flipflop designs as it is considered to be a universal device.
You start with a design, analyze it, and then refine the design to make it faster, less expensive, etc. In a sequential logic circuit the outputs depend on the inputs plus its history. Feel free to use your own strategy to build a 2to4 decoder as an alternative to the one in fig. A c2mosbased pipelined circuit is racefree as long as all the logic. Methodology for manipulation of karnaugh maps designing for pne umatic sequential logic circuits 47 this paper is a revised and expanded version of a paper entitled teaching control pneumatic and. Dynamic circuits can realize the pipelined system in a very efficient and compact way. Mealy machines, shifters, registers, counters structural and behavioral verilog for combinational and sequential logic labs 1, 2, 3. The basic logic design steps are generally identical for sequential and combinational circuits. Designing sequential logic circuits semester b, 201617 lecturer. In this design, the state assignment may be important because the use of a good state assignment can reduce the required number of product terms and, hence reduce the required size of the pla.
Sequential pipelined circuits need good latches and registers for speed performance. Both the inputs and outputs can reach either of the two states. The positive feedback effect makes a manual derivation of propagation delay of the. Not practical for use in synchronous sequential circuits. Dandamudi outline introduction clock signal propagation delay latches sr latch clocked sr latch d latch jk latch flip flops d flip. The design of a synchronous sequential circuit starts from a set of specifications and culminates in a logic diagram or a list of boolean functions from which a logic diagram can be obtained. Sequential circuit design cont d build a design table that consists of. Combinational logic and sequential logic are the building blocks of digital system design. Easy to build using jk flipflops use the jk 11 to toggle. Algebraic manipulation as seen in examples karnaugh k mapping a visual approach. Pdf designing asynchronous sequential circuits for. Understanding this process allows the designer to better use the cad tools, and, if need be, to design critical logic sub circuits by hand.
We will be using manual processes for most of this text to designanalyze digital circuits. Sequential logic circuits and the sr flipflop electronicstutorials. Sr or jk flipflops are used zsince truth tables with dont care entries frequently result in circuit simplifications, this favors jk flipflops. It is a storage device capable of storing one bit of data. Consist of a combinational circuit to which storage elements are connected to form a feedback path. Output is a function of both the present state and the input.
Designing sequential logic circuits implementation techniques for flipflops, latches, oscillators, pulse generators, n and schmitt triggers n static versus dynamic realization choosing clocking strategies 7. Output depends on current, past as well as clock inputs. Logic minimisation any boolean function can be implemented directly using combinational logic gates however, simplifying the boolean function will enable the number of gates required to be reduced. These circuits employ storage elements and logic gates. H thapliyal and n rangan athan 8 were the fir st people to intr oduce the r eversible logic to sequential circuits. Designing sequential logic circuits seminar presentation pdf. Consequently the output is solely a function of the current inputs. In sequential logic the output of the logic device is dependent not only on the present inputs to the device, but also on past inputs. Representations state diagrams, transition tables, moore vs. Combinational logic circuits circuits without a memory. Formal sequential circuit synthesis summary of design steps.
From simple gates to complex sequential circuits, plot timing diagrams, automatic circuit generation, explore standard ics, and much more for free. Sequential and combinational logic circuits types of logic. Note that there are dont care entries whenever there are fewer states than possible state vectors. Very useful, simple tool for designing digital circuits very useful, simple tool for designing digital circuits neowerdna january 25, 2012 version. Sequential logic sequential circuits simple circuits with feedback latches edgetriggered flipflops timing methodologies cascading flipflops for proper operation clock skew asynchronous inputs metastability and synchronization basic registers shift registers simple counters hardware description languages and sequential logic. Block diagram of sequential circuit designing of sequential circuit using plas. Experimental section1 you will build an adder using 7400nand and 7402nor gates, as an example of combinational logic circuit.
Jan 12, 2019 in this tutorial, we will learn about sequential circuits, what is sequential logic, how are sequential circuits different from combinational circuits, different types of sequential circuits, a few important sequential circuits basics and many more. Jk inputs for each flipflop binary counter example. Circuitverse allows multibit wires buses and subcircuits. Combinational and sequential logic circuits hardware.
In other words, the output state of a sequential logic circuit is a function of the. Apr 08, 2012 using state tables to design sequential circuits. Give sequence to events which allows ordering of operations. Download pdf of designing sequential logic circuits seminar presentation offline reading, offline notes, free download in app, engineering class handwritten notes, exam notes, previous year questions, pdf free download. Digital electronics part i combinational and sequential. Digital logic circuits lecture pdf 19p this note covers the following topics. In this type of logic circuits outputs depend on the current inputs and previous inputs. They are timeindependent and dont need clock inputs. The basic building block of the combinational circuit has logic gates, while indeed the basic building block of a sequential circuit is a flipflop. So far we have investigated combinational logic for which the output of the logic devices circuits depends only on the present state of the inputs. Download an insight into sequential logic circuits pdf 17p download free.
In this course material we design and analyze only synchronous sequential logic. Next states and outputs are functions of inputs and present states of storage elements 54 two types of sequential circuits. Free logic circuits books download ebooks online textbooks. Sequential logic circuits use flipflops as memory elements and in which their.
Designing sequential logic circuits seminar presentation. Sequential circuit design university of pittsburgh. Designing of sequential circuits using pla elprocus. Pdf electronic circuits can be separated into two groups, digital and analog circuits. Current trend is not to use dynamic cmos for normalspeed operations in largescaled designs.
1578 588 306 1348 560 1401 421 490 295 1609 26 1445 1071 191 677 287 1087 395 1436 1512 1453 165 804 841 1425 1279 995 1466 425 76 1526 840 1307 351 588 215 133 1337 1062 541 166